Position Summary
We are seeking an experienced Senior Signal Integrity Engineer to lead SI/PI design and validation activities for next-generation high-speed networking, AI, and data center products.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in high-speed PCB design, simulation, measurement, and correlation across complex systems operating at 112G and 224G data rates.
Responsibilities
- Lead Signal Integrity and Power Integrity analysis for complex PCB and system designs.
- Define SI/PI architecture, design rules, and channel budgets for high-speed interfaces.
- Perform detailed channel simulations and optimization using industry-standard tools.
- Drive correlation between simulation and laboratory measurements.
- Develop and validate models for packages, PCBs, connectors, cables, and complete channels.
- Conduct pre-layout and post-layout SI/PI analysis.
- Perform compliance and interoperability analysis for industry standards.
- Debug complex signal integrity issues and drive root-cause resolution.
- Define PCB stackups, routing requirements, via structures, and return path strategies.
- Mentor junior engineers and provide technical leadership across projects.
- Collaborate with silicon, package, board, mechanical, and manufacturing teams.
- Interface with vendors and customers on SI/PI-related technical topics.
